I believe there are 3 types of spray,
Dry, which is the easiest to install, but hardest on the engine
Wet, which is a bit more difficult to install, but a little bit easier on the engine
direct port, which is very difficult to install, requires plumbing, drilling and so forth, but is the safest bet for the engine.
If you though ou were just going to go on eBay and buy a kit for $100, slap it on the car in 30 minutes and go smoke Corvettes, it's just not going to happen

Ken, Direct port nitrous is just a way to install a nitrous system. You can have both dry and wet direct port sytems...
Direct port is the way to make the best POWA....
